The Dytran model 3262C takes high temperature vibration testing to a new level. The single axis charge mode accelerometer operates up to +1200°F (+649°C)––a breakthrough product in the sensor field. The model has 5 pC/g sensitivity with a 2500 upper frequency range. The 3262C is case ground isolated and hermetically sealed.
The main applications of 3262C are: Engine test cell; Vibration health monitoring; Powerplants with gas and steam turbines; and Nuclear power plants
